PUNISHING PROMOTION OF USTASHA SYMBOLS - FIRST STEP IN COMBATING HISTORICAL REVISIONISM

BELGRADE, JULY 11 /SRNA/ - President of the Movement of Serbs from Krajina, Mile Bosnić, told SRNA that the adoption of amendments to the Criminal Code of Republika Srpska, introducing prison sentences for displaying and glorifying the symbols of the NDH and the so-called Army of BiH, is an exceptionally good move and the first step in confronting the widespread historical revisionism that has taken hold.

Bosnić believes that it is high time to put things in order and, as he said, put an end to the arrogance of those who, by displaying symbols under which horrific crimes against Serbs were committed, humiliate the victims and their descendants. "It is unacceptable for Ustasha symbols to appear in public, including in cemeteries. The same applies to the flags of the so-called Army of BiH, whose members committed numerous crimes against Serbs. This is pure insolence and deeply offensive. That is why the legal amendments are good, but they must be enforced," Bosnić said. Bosnić pointed out that what Bosniaks are doing is unacceptable – they are marching in what is called a peace march while carrying flags under which criminals cut off Serbs' heads and played football with them. "The law is what it should be, but it must be enforced. That is the key point," Bosnić stressed. He assessed that the amendments to the Criminal Code in Republika Srpska are important also because they help curb historical revisionism and the relativisation of Ustasha crimes, as well as other atrocities committed against Serbs. "This is the first serious step in that direction. An end must be put to this, and this has now been clearly stated at the level of the law as well. The symbols of a genocidal Ustasha state, which committed crimes that horrified people around the world, cannot be displayed or glorified. That must be clear to everyone," Bosnić stressed. The National Assembly of Republika Srpska adopted the Law on Amendments to the Criminal Code of Republika Srpska, which bans the displaying and glorification of the symbols of the NDH and the so-called Army of BiH, and prescribes prison sentences for such acts. Amendments to the Law on Cemeteries and Funeral Services were also adopted, introducing penalties for displaying these symbols in cemeteries.
